Today, at 2 PM, ESPN will, for the first time ever, broadcast a live, regular-season dual. The dual between the 4th ranked Hawkeyes and the 8th ranked Cyclowns will be broadcast from Ames with the potential to make viewership history and expose the sport to millions of people. With permission from @The-Dude-Abides the greatest analytical mind in the sport of wrestling, here is a writeup he did about this meet in the wrestling forum, we thank you sir!:

Some strikes and gutters, ups and downs today against Oregon State, but on to the next one. ISU has dropped 17 straight duals to Iowa, last winning in 2004. This could be their best chance in years to knock out the Hawks, which would obviously piss us all off a great deal.

Rankings per Intermat.

#8 Iowa vs. # 10 Iowa State

125: #11 Ayala vs. #17 Kysen Terukina. Terukina majored Eric #6 Barnett today, which was surprising, and Drake looked off this afternoon. I'm gonna say today's loss motivates Drake to bounce back and win by decision. Hawks 3-0.

133: #9 Teske vs. #18 Evan Frost. I like Teske by a comfortable decision. Hawks 6-0.

141: #1 Woods vs. #15 (at 149) Anthony Echemendia. I think Real is able to get to his legs and maybe a turn. Real by decision. Hawks 9-0.

149: # 9 VV vs. Casey Swiderski (NR by Intermat, Flo has him at #13). Swid beat #14 Zargo pretty handily today and can be hard to score on. VV needs to clean up his finishes to win this one. I'm going with Swid in a close decision. Hawks 9-3.

157: #2 Franek vs. #19 Cody Chittum. Hilton could be salty in this one after Chittum decommitted from Iowa. I think Franek controls this match as a savvy veteran, wins by decision. Hawks 12-3.

165: #5 Caliendo vs. #2 David Carr. Carr is just on a different tier, wins by decision. Hawks 12-6.

174: NR Arnold vs. #22 MJ Gaitan. Assuming Gabe goes again, I like him to control this match from neutral and push to get the major. Hawks 16-6.

184: #29 Stafford vs. #5 Will Feldkamp. Will need something big to pull this match out. Feldkamp by major, Hawks 16-10.

197: #23 Glazier vs. #25 Julien Broderson. This will be a big one. Think Glazier gets a TD late to seal it in a gritty decision. Hawks 19-10.

Heavy: NR Hill vs. #7 Yonger Bastida. Mismatch here, but I'm gonna say Hill is able to keep it to a major. Wouldn't matter for the dual if the previous go as above. Hawks win 19-14.

Not much room for error, and we almost have to have wins at 25, 33, 74, and 97. I will not be going, as I can't stand that stinking place and its fans.
